Planting Calendar for Bloodleaf

Frost tolerance for bloodleaf: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After the last frost when the weather gets warmer.

You should not plant bloodleaf until after the last frost has passed because they require warm weather.

The earliest that you can plant bloodleaf in Oak Grove is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ant bloodleaf and expect a good harvest is probably August. Any later than that and your bloodleaf may not have a chance to really do well. If you are starting your bloodleaf ind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a few we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

The average date of last frost is April 15 in Oak Grove. It might get as low as -10°F during the coldest months of winter.

Remember that USDA zone info for Oak Grove is just an average and the actual date of last frost can change quite a bit from year to year. Since half of the time in Oak Grove last frost occurs after April 15 be ready to cover your bloodleaf in the event of a surprise late frost.
